网络管理答案(第3版) 下载本文

NEF MF NEF Qx Q3接口 Qx Qx Qx Qx Q3接口

2. 设计一个 OS对某一个远程中继站(如卫星地面站、微波中继站等)中多个 传输终端碱性监测,检查传输链路的信号质量。要求此 OS能够获取单位时 间内出现信号质量低于阙值问题的传输链路个数,设此管理信息被定义为被 管对象 lowQualityLinkNumber。请提出一个基于 TMN 的合理方案,指出 系统中包涵的物理元素及其接口,各物理元素应包含的功能模块以及 lowQualityLinkNumber 被管对象在何处实现。 TMN MD OS NE WS F接口 Qx接口

Q3接口

lowQualityLinkNumber 在 MD处实现。

3. 某大学开发了一个 TMN,用于管理分散在各教学楼中的网络交换机和路由 器。题图 3.1 是该 TMN的物理配置示意图。要求:

1) 标出各个接口的类型; 2) 简述各个元素的作用;

3) 描述 OS与 MD中的信息交换实体(角色)和作用。 1) WS MD OS NE DCN F接口 Qx接口 Q3接口 Q3接口

2)WS:操作员与 TMN之间进行交互,提供和图形用户接口和人机接口; OS:对网络交换机进行监测和控制;

DCN:实现信息传输,理由选择,中继和互通;

MD:对多个 NE的信息进行集中,处理,转送给 OS;

NE:对网络交换机和路由器的数据进行备份,进行故障分析,测试,自 检,故障隔离等操作。

3)OS:Magager 角色,发起对被管对象NE 的操作,接收由 MD传上来的通 报和数据。

MD:Agent 角色,接收 OS发来的指令,传递给 NE,集中NE的信息, 上报给 OS。

MD发起对 NE的操作,接收由 NE传来的通报和数据,NE接收 MD的 指令。

4. 上题中,假设OS和 WS设置在网络中心,MD和 NE配置个教学楼,请为 DCN选择一种合理的实现技术,并说明 OS和 WS、MD和 NE之间的通信 方式。

采用 LAN 技术实现DCN比较合适,因为 MD与 NE 分布在各教学楼且学校 中各教学楼距离较近,才用 LAN 比较经济,实现比较容易。

第四章 SNMP网络管理模型 思考题

1. SNMP是怎么发展起来的?与 CMIP相比有哪些特点?

发展历程略。

特点:开发速度快、没有 CMIP那样复杂的概念,结构简单、体系结构非对 称。

2. 简述 SNMP系统模型以及网络管理协议体系结构。

SNMP的体系结构一般是非对称的,即 Magager 实体和 Agent 实体一般被分 割配置。 管理站可以向代理下达操作命令访问代理所在系统的管理信息。 Magager 和 Agent 均为应用层实体,基于 TCP/IP协议簇中的 UDP协议的支持,图见 P104-41

3. 什么是陷阱引导的轮询?SNMP为什么采用这样的机制?

管理站以不太频繁的周期进行一次初始化,其间管理站轮询所有的代理,将

需要监测的关键信息读取出来,有了基准以后,管理站便降低轮询频度,此后便 有各个代理站通过发送 trap 消息向管理站报告重要事件。

原因:如管理站下的代理较多,则简单轮询方式会使管理信息的监测周期过 长,不能做到及时的管理,同时,周期性送上来的信息中会有很多是管理站不需 要的,因而白白浪费了通信资源。

4. 代管代理的作用是什么?它需要什么样的协议体系结构?

代管一方面配置 SNMP Agent 与 SNMP 管理站通信,另一方面配备一个或多 个托管设备支持的协议,与托管设备通信。 协议体系结构见 Page 106 图 4.2

5. SNMP中的被管对象有哪些数据类型?

INTEGER、OCTET、STRING、OBJECT、IDENTIFIER、NULL、IpAddress、 Counter、TimeTicks、Opaque。

6. 如何定义 SNMP的被管对象类?

1)给出它的标识符:通过 DESCRIPTOR和 OBJECT、IDENTIFIER确定; 2)说明它的句法:包括名称、数据类型、访问权限、状态等项目的定义。 3)确定它的编码模式:采用编码规则 BER 实现 Magager 和 Agent之间的管 理信息编码传输,可根据数据的类型,长度和值进行编码。 4)为简化和规范定义方法:SMI 提供了一个被管对象类的

MACRO—OBJECT—TYPE。(MACRO:只要为它提供适当的参数,就可以定 义具体的被管对象类)

7. 请描述 SNMP中的 MIB结构,MIB中那些被管对象是能够实际访问的? 结构图见 Page108图 4.3,顶点为1.3.6.1,internet{1.3.6.1}之下定义了4个子 树 directory、agent、expermential、private。MIB树上每一节点对应一个被管对 象,节点的所属关系也就是被管对象的包含关系,只有处于叶子位置上的对象是 可以直接访问的—称为基本被管对象。

8. 请说明 SNMP的管理信息模型中怎样定义表格?为什么要利用表格组织被 管对象?

SMI 提供SEQUENCE 和 SEUENCE of 两个机制定义结构化数据类型的被管 对象。利用这两个机制可以构造二维表格。调用 OBJECT—TYPE MACRO,并 给出 IndexPart 的参数,也可以规范的定义二维表格。 表格组织被管对象使对象结构清晰,易于访问。

9. MIB-II 中包含哪些分组?各分组中存储哪些信息? 见 Page117 表 4.4

10. 简述基于 Community概念的 SNMP安全机制?

Community 是一个在代理中定义的本地的概念可每组可选的认证、访问控制 和代管特性建立一个 Community。每个 Community 被赋予一个在代理内部唯一 的 Community 名,提供给Community 内所有的管理站。一个代理可与多个管理 站建立多个 Community,同一个管理站也可出现在不同的 Community。

11. 怎样在 SNMP的 MIB中标识纵列对象?

1)随机访问技术:将索引对象值连接在纵列对象标识符之后的方法标识纵裂 对象的实例。

2)顺序访问技术:利用图书编目顺序实现,把对象标识符的整数序列看做书 的章节编号,则前后顺序就有了明确的排列方法。

12. 什么是被管对象的图书编目式排序?

见上题

13. 为什么 SNMP PDU中要包含 request-id字段?

Request-id是赋予每个请求的唯一标识符,这样可以使处理响应请求准确无 误,不致引起混乱和请求丢失。

习题

1. 请画出一个多Magager 体系结构的示意图。

Magager Magager Magager Agent

2. 试利用 OBJECT-TYPE MACRO 定义 MIB-II 中的 atTable 被管对象。 atTable OBJECT—TYPE

SYNTAX SEQUENCE OF AtEntry ACCESS not=accessible STATUS mandatory

DESCRIPTION

“This value should include the mapping from the network’s address to the physical address” ::={at 1}

3. 请分别写出OBJECT IDENTIFIER system 和 IpAddress(202.112.108.158) 这两个数据的TLV编码。

OBJECT IDENTIFIER SYSTEM 的 TLV编码:

00000110 00000110 00101011 00000110 00000001 00000010 00000001 00000001

System的标识符{1.3.6.1.2.1} –>{43.6.1.2.1.1} IpAddress{202.112.108.158}的 TLV编码:

IpAddress位于位于 ip组中,ipRouteTable->ipRouteEntry->ipRoutePest,标识 符{1.3.6.1.2.1.4.21.1.1.202.112.108.158}

数据类型 IpAddress 编码如下:

01000000 00001110 00000001 00000011 00000001 00000010

00000001 00000100 00010101 00000001 00000001 11001010 01110000 01101100 10011110

4-4 请画出MIB II 中 ip 组中的 ipRouteTable 被管对象及其所包含的被管对象的 对象标识符子树。 答: ipRouteDest(1) ipRouteIfIndex(2) ipRouteMetrc1(3) ipRouteMetrc2(4) ipRouteMetrc3(5) ipRouteMetrc4(6) ipRouteNextHop(7) ipRouteInfo(13) ipRouteMetrc5(12) ipRouteMask(11) ipRouteAge(10) ipRouteProto(9) ipRouteType(8)